Philly Nonprofit Providing Tech Workshops For Girls Expands To Delaware

We’re excited to share that TechGirlz will soon be expanding their operations to Delaware. The program is currently a nonprofit based in Philadelphia that focuses on providing free tech workshops to middle-school girls. With Delaware’s prevalence of financial companies, the program will be including fintech training as well to offer the most relevant curriculum possible.

“As Delaware’s financial technology industry continues to grow, this partnership will help inspire a future workforce of diversified talent that will make our state and its innovative companies even more competitive,” said Meghan Wallace, cofounder of First State Fintech Lab, in a statement. “By engaging early with young women and providing them with a path to rewarding careers in the fintech industry, we can build a more diverse financial services ecosystem while providing our girls with greater access and opportunities.”

TechGirlz workshops across the country focus on various STEM topics, including robotics, gaming, digital design and podcasting. The new Delaware program, slated to launch in the first half of 2020, will add fintech to the list, with workshops that teach both technology training and financial literacy education.
